http://www.ausbt.com.au/virgin-australia-s-new-airbus-a330-lie-flat-business-class-seats
While all of Virgin's new A330s will sport the new business class seats, a spokesperson for the airline confirmed to Australian Business Traveller that its first two A330s -- which were bought 'pre-loved' from Emirates and currently fly Sydney-Perth -- would not be upgraded to install the new business class seating or remove the middle seat from that aircraft's 2-3-2 layout.
